通过使用zip()函数,我们可以实现在for循环后面接多个变量的需求。zip()函数将多个可迭代对象打包成一个新的可迭代对象,我们可以在for循环中使用多个变量分别接收每个元素。这样,我们就能够同时遍历多个可迭代对象并执行相应的操作。 希望本文能够帮助你理解如何实现“python for in后面可以接多个变量”。如果你还有任何...
print(item) #打印出L中的所有元素,即两个列表元素 1. 2. 3. (2):嵌套循环:for循环体内嵌套另一个for循环 L = [["monica", "生生", "小黄", "helen", "冷夜"], ["不想睡", "心动"], ["lili"]],遍历出变量值中每个元素 for item in L: # 每循环一次拿到一个子列表,赋值给item for a...
2. 想要通过for循环对数组里面的每个变量赋值(这里的变量可以是另外一个数组) 3. 通过for循环打印每个变量 方案一:使用globals()[]和eval()两个函数 1. 赋值部分: var_list = ["one", "two", "three"] num = 1 for var in var_list: globals()[var] = num num += 1 2. 打印部分 forvarinvar...
我试图更深入地了解 for 如何在 Python 中循环不同的数据类型。使用 for 循环遍历数组的最简单方法是 for i in range(len(array)): do_something(array[i]) 我也知道我可以 for i in array: do_something(i) 我想知道的是这是做什么的 for i, j in range(len(array)): # What is i and j ...
1 第一步,定义一个字典数据类型的变量A,并进行赋值,字典中的元素是以键值对的形式,如下图所示:2 第二步,使用for...in语句遍历字典数据类型变量A,获取A中的key值,如下图所示:3 第三步,除了遍历字典数据类型的,还可以遍历字符串类型的变量,获取对应的单个字符,如下图所示:4 第四步,使用for......
for...in循环的基本语法如下所示:for 变量 in 可迭代对象:(tab)循环体 其中,变量是用来接收可迭代对象中的每个元素的名称,可迭代对象是要遍历的数据集合,循环体是对每个元素进行的操作。二、遍历列表 列表是Python中最常用的可迭代对象之一。通过for...in循环,我们可以遍历列表中的元素,并对其进行操作。例如...
for in的基本语法如下: ``` for 变量 in 可迭代对象: 执行代码块 ``` 其中,变量表示每次迭代时的取值,可迭代对象是一个包含多个元素的集合,可以是列表、元组、字符串、字典、集合等。 ### 2. 遍历列表 我们可以使用for in循环遍历列表中的每个元素,如下所示: ```python fruits = ['apple', 'banana',...
python中for循环用法 1、在python中完整的for语法如下 #for变量in集合: # 循环代码 #else: # 没有通过的break退出循环,结束后会执行代码 2、应用场景 在迭代变量嵌套的数据类型时,列表【数组】中包括多个字典【键值对存放的值:用{key:value}】 需求:要判断某一个字典中是否存在要遍历的值...
在Python的for循环中实现多变量可以通过使用元组或列表的方式来实现。具体的方法如下: 使用元组: 在for循环中,可以使用元组将多个变量绑定在一起。每次迭代时,元组中的变量将按顺序接收迭代的值。 示例代码: 代码语言:txt 复制 fruits = [('apple', 1), ('banana', 2), ('orange', 3)] ...
python 推导式多个for循环 示例如下: In [5]: [(i,j) for i in range(10) for j in range(2) ] Out[5]: [(0, 0), (0, 1), (1, 0), (1, 1), (2, 0), (2, 1), (3, 0), (3, 1), (4, 0), (4, 1), (5, 0), (5, 1), (6, 0), (6, 1), (7, 0)...